Group 1 - The core issue affecting the liquor industry is the changing supply and demand dynamics, significantly influenced by e-commerce promotions, leading to a shift towards mid-to-low-end liquor products as high-end liquor prices decline [1] - The consensus among liquor companies this year includes inventory reduction, relieving pressure on distributors, and focusing on the banquet and mass market, with a notable shift towards lower alcohol content products [2][6] - Yanghe Brewery has initiated a rapid inventory reduction strategy, which has shown signs of stabilization in key performance indicators despite initial challenges in the first half of the year [2][7] Group 2 - The challenge for liquor companies is to synchronize inventory reduction with distributor support, balancing the need to reduce their own inventory while alleviating the burden on distributors [3] - Yanghe Brewery's strategy involves sacrificing short-term performance to relieve inventory pressure, focusing on key markets and maintaining stable prices for main products, resulting in a significant reduction in distributor burdens [4] - The introduction of new channels and the launch of popular products have contributed to a notable decrease in Yanghe's inventory levels, with a nearly 60% reduction in inventory goods compared to the beginning of the year [4] Group 3 - The demand for mid-to-low-end products has surged, prompting liquor companies to adapt by launching high-quality, low-cost products to meet the needs of younger consumers [6] - Yanghe Brewery's collaboration with e-commerce giant JD.com has led to the successful launch of its high-line light bottle liquor, achieving significant sales milestones shortly after its release [6] - Recent quarterly reports indicate a recovery in distributor confidence and a narrowing decline in revenue, suggesting a potential stabilization in the market [7]

Core Insights - Yanghe Co., Ltd. reported a significant decline in both revenue and net profit for Q3 2025, indicating challenges in the current market environment [1][3] Financial Performance - Total revenue for the company was 18.09 billion yuan, ranking 5th among disclosed peers, a decrease of 9.43 billion yuan or 34.26% year-on-year [1] - Net profit attributable to shareholders was 3.975 billion yuan, also ranking 5th among peers, down by 4.604 billion yuan or 53.66% year-on-year [1] - Operating cash flow was 966 million yuan, ranking 6th among peers, a decline of 2.492 billion yuan or 72.06% year-on-year [1] Key Ratios - The latest debt-to-asset ratio stood at 18.22%, ranking 4th among peers, a decrease of 1.74 percentage points from the previous quarter but an increase of 1.77 percentage points year-on-year [3] - Gross margin was 71.10%, ranking 9th among peers, down by 3.92 percentage points from the previous quarter and 2.71 percentage points year-on-year [3] - Return on equity (ROE) was 8.19%, ranking 9th among peers, a decrease of 7.85 percentage points year-on-year [3] Earnings Per Share and Turnover - Diluted earnings per share were 2.64 yuan, ranking 6th among peers, a decrease of 3.06 yuan or 53.66% year-on-year [3] - Total asset turnover ratio was 0.29 times, ranking 12th among peers, down by 0.13 times or 30.57% year-on-year [3] - Inventory turnover ratio was 0.27 times, ranking 9th among peers, a decrease of 0.12 times or 30.06% year-on-year [3] Shareholder Structure - The number of shareholders was 164,100, with the top ten shareholders holding 1.111 billion shares, accounting for 73.75% of total equity [3] - Major shareholders include Jiangsu Yanghe Group Co., Ltd. with 34.1%, Jiangsu Blue Alliance Co., Ltd. with 17.5%, and Shanghai Haiyan Logistics Development Co., Ltd. with 9.67% [3]

Core Viewpoint - Jiangsu Yanghe Brewery Co., Ltd. reported a net loss of 369 million yuan in Q3 2025, indicating significant financial challenges amid a declining market for liquor sales [2][5]. Financial Performance - For the first three quarters of 2025, the company achieved operating revenue of 18.09 billion y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 34.26% [2][3]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ders was 3.98 billion yuan, down 53.66% year-on-year [2][3]. - In Q3 alone, the operating revenue was 3.30 billion yuan, a decline of 29.01% compared to the same period last year [2][3]. - The net profit for Q3 turned into a loss of 369 million yuan, contrasting with a profit of 631 million yuan in the same quarter last year [2][3]. - The cash flow from operating activities decreased by 72.06% year-on-year, primarily due to reduced sales revenue [5]. Shareholder Information - The top three shareholders are Jiangsu Yanghe Group Co., Ltd. (34.18%), Jiangsu Blue Alliance Co., Ltd. (17.59%), and Shanghai Haiyan Logistics Development Co., Ltd. (9.67%) [6][7]. - During the reporting period, two shareholders increased their holdings while three reduced theirs, indicating mixed investor sentiment [6][7]. Industry Context - The liquor industry is currently experiencing a deep adjustment phase, with a reported 9.90% decline in production among major liquor enterprises in China from January to September 2025 [8]. - Yanghe Brewery noted that the competitive landscape in the liquor industry is intensifying, particularly among leading brands, necessitating improved operational capabilities [8].
